Handover — Eventspine schema registry

Taking over from me: compat checks run on every schema publish; plugin authors must register namespaces before pushing. Known issue: the validator cache goes stale after registry restarts — flush it manually. Deploys are weekly, Tuesdays. The registry's encrypted config bundle needs unsealing after each restart; on-call handles it, but you should hold a copy too. The recovery passphrase for the bundle is below.

vault phrase of taweg-kafof = oliax-zorael

/*
 * Client setup for the Quillhook resolver service.
 * Context: we saw flaky DNS resolution against the internal
 * Quillhook hostname during pod restarts — lookups intermittently
 * returned stale records for up to 30 seconds. We now pin the
 * resolver cache TTL to 5s and retry failed lookups three times
 * with backoff. Do not remove these settings without load-testing.
 * Authenticate using the service key below.
 */

service key, fawip-bajef: kto11_Qt5wZK9vdNC

# Break-Glass Access: Fabrikit Test-Data Factory

Welcome aboard. Fabrikit, the Dunmore Software test-data factory library, pulls seed schemas from a locked registry. If the registry token expires mid-sprint and no staff maintainer is reachable, contractors may use break-glass access. File a notice in the ops channel afterward. The recovery passphrase for break-glass is below.

recovery phrase for bawef-haduf: wenax-druox-julmir